These riders are coming to a huge Black Hills Harley Davidson event held just outside Rapid City. Thousands park during the day and visit the booths and vendors. The Indian Motorcycle Manufacturing Company was established in the year 1901 in Springfield Ma. This is one of the very few motorcycles that I’ve never ridden. I hear they are great motorcycles and they are Beautiful bikes.
